ID:70330 

E. A. from Harlow

Tuesday 21 June 2022 (3 years ago)

Area:Middle Wye

Beat:Whitney Court

Fishing:Coarse

No. of Anglers:1

River water level quite low. Weather 30+ degrees, cloud 0/8. No show of Barbel as previous visits but managed to catch two very nice Chub. (4/14 & 5/2 Ibs). Tactics used - 12ft rod, sliding open ended feeder loaded with ground bait, small pellets and hemp seed. 0.5m hook length, 14mm banded pellet and size 12 wide gape BARBLESS hook. Also enjoyed the two common sandpiper birds bombing up and down the river - obviously nesting nearby. :)

2 Chub

ID:68551 

J. B. from Colwyn Bay

Tuesday 21 June 2022 (3 years ago)

Area:Upland Llyns

Beat:Llyn Coedty (Dolgarrog Fishing Club)

Fishing:Trout (Stillwater)

No. of Anglers:2

Started fishing 5:30, water in reservoir very low and mud a bit tricky to negotiate. A number of fish rising so started with dry (black) fly and caught one brown trout (10”) which we returned. As morning warmed up I swapped to various combinations wet fly, indicator/dropper etc then moved to lures as daughter was being successful spinning with size 3 mepps. She got 3 brownies between 8” - 10”, again returned. Day got really hot and sunny so just about to pack up at 10:30 when I had a cheeky punt with a dry (black) fly at a rise nearby and landed a lovely brownie. 14”, 425g. Took that home.

5 Trout
